    The Freemasons describe themselves as a secret society. In English, the word "secret" has two senses that are quite distinct. In modern English, we use the word almost exclusively in the sense of something that is being concealed. In olden times, however, the word was not only used in this way, and it was sometimes used in a sense more like we use the word "private" today. Today, I would not describe my driver's license as "secret" but, say, 200 years ago, that would have been a valid description of it. "Secret documents" didn't necessarily mean documents that contain incriminating or strategically sensitive information... it could just mean "private". If the Freemasons are merely a private society, then there is nothing inherently evil in that.

    A deal with the devil (also called a Faustian bargain or Mephistophelian bargain) is a cultural motif in European folklore, best exemplified by the legend of Faust and the figure of Mephistopheles, as well as being elemental to many Christian traditions. According to traditional Christian belief about witchcraft, the pact is between a person and Satan or a lesser demon. The person offers their soul in exchange for diabolical favours. Those favours vary by the tale, but tend to include youth, knowledge, wealth, fame, or power.

    The Devil’s Bridge by Johann Christoph Haizmann (1651 to 1700)
    From autobiographical texts, J.C.Haizmann sold his soul to the devil in 1668 at ~17 years of age.

    Haizmann claimed that he gave two pacts to the devil, one written in ink and other in his own blood.

    Haizmann’s votive painting (triptych) of 1677-78.

    Left: Satan appears as a fine burgher, and Haizmann signs a pact with ink.

    Right: The Devil reappears a year later and forces Haizmann to sign another pact with his own blood.

    Middle: The Virgin Mary makes the Devil return the second pact during an exorcism.

    Johann Christoph Haizmann (1651 to 1700) was a Bavarian-born Austrian painter who is known for his autobiographically depicted demoniacal neurosis. The so-called Haizmann case has been studied in psychology and psychiatry since the early twentieth century, especially by Sigmund Freud and Gaston Vandendriessche.

    The ARC de Triomphe du Carrousel (firmly anchored to the tradition of the ancient triumphal arches) was built by Percier and Fontaine in circa 1806 to 1808 to celebrate the Napoleonic victories of 1805, and it was originally intended as a monumental entrance to the Tuileries palace. When that palace was destroyed by fire in 1871, it was generally agreed that the arch stood well on its own; nor was the palace greatly missed in that an exceptional view of the Champs-Elysées had been opened up.

    The proportions of the arch were directly drawn from those of the Arch of Septimius Severus in Rome; furthermore Percier and Fontaine deliberately copied ancient decorative motifs of Corinthian columns in red and white marble, bas-reliefs depicting the major events of the campaign and a chariot pulled by four horses at the top. Each of the eight columns has (above it) a statue of a soldier of the Grand Army, namely: a dragoon, an infantry grenadier, a cavalry chasseur, a grenadier, a gunner, a rifleman and a sapper. The bas-reliefs illustrate the following events: (facing the Louvre) “The Surrender at Ulm” by Cartellier and “The battle of Austerlitz” by Esparcieux; (facing the rue de Rivoli) “Napoleon entering Munich” and “Napoleon bringing back the King of Bavaria” by Clodion; (facing the Tuileries Gardens) “Napoleon entering Vienna” by Deseine and “The Meeting of the two Emperors” by Ramey; (facing the Seine) “The Peace of Presbourg” by Lesueur.

    Originally, “The Horses of Saint Mark's”, the famous bronzes removed from the Basilica in Venice, crowned the building, but these originals were sent back to Venice in 1815 and replaced by copies, and the statue group was completed by an allegory of the Restoration surrounded by two Victories by Bosio.

    What were Federation ARCHes?

    Australia’s passage into the British ‘Commonwealth’ prompted an outbreak of ARCH building…?!

    Australia Under CONTRACT with the ARCH - 1901 by Prince Arthur, on Flickr

    On 1 January 1901, the Commonwealth of Australia was inaugurated in Sydney and various elaborately constructed ARCHes graced the streets. In Melbourne, an ARCH declaring “Melbourne rejoices in the Commonwealth” was erected. However, with many of Victoria’s politicians and public figures in Sydney for the inauguration, Melbourne’s celebrations were largely put on hold until May that year, when the Duke and Duchess of Cornwall and York would visit to open the first Commonwealth Parliament.

    In May, a number of temporary TRIumphal ARCHes were built in Melbourne, St Kilda and Ballarat; some small country towns also built their own more modest ARCHes.

    The early Renaissance or Roman-Doric design bore similarities to other famous ARCHes: the Arc de Triomphe du Carrousel (1808) in Paris and the Marble ARCH (1828) in London. They in turn were inspired by Roman structures like the ARCH of Septimius Severus (203 AD) in Libya, and the ARCH of Constantine (316 AD) in Rome.

    The TRIumphal ARCHes were often adorned with royal symbols, images, colours and patriotic mottoes.
